    Wednesday’s Den: Mid-week musings…….

    13) If you’re a talking head on national TV on college football Saturdays, could please learn what the term “upset” means? It is pretty simple.

    Can’t remember who said it, but Kansas State (ranked #19) lost at Oklahoma State last week; a studio host called the loss “an upset” because the ranked team lost.

    Here’s the thing: Oklahoma State was FAVORED by six points; not only did the favorite win, they covered the spread. “Upsets” are when the underdog wins.

    Just do better, it isn’t difficult.

    12) Arkansas football coach Sam Pittman has an interesting resume; from 1984-2019, before he got the head coaching job with the Razorbacks, he was the offensive line coach at 15 different high schools, colleges. Imagine moving 14 times in 35 years?

    Tuesday’s Den: Nobody asked me, but…….

    13) This week in 1974, big league pitcher Tommy John had the UCL in his left arm repaired by Dr Frank Jobe; Astros’ pitching coach Brent Strom was the second guy to have that surgery.

    Obviously, Tommy John surgery has helped a ton of pitchers resume the careers; shouldn’t Dr Jobe be in the Baseball Hall of Fame? They put freakin’ Marvin Miller in the Hall last month; all he did was make the players wealthy. Did he really help the game of baseball at all?

    Dr Frank Jobe needs to be inducted into the Baseball Hall of Fame.

    8) New Orleans Saints are 2-1, but they’ve only had three plays of 20+ yards. With Drew Brees in New Orleans, we came to expect an explosive offense, but Brees is retired, so now they depend lot more on their defense.

    2) Washington Nationals’ 1B Josh Bell grew up in Texas, where high school football is a really big deal, but his dad got hurt playing football when he was young, so he wouldn’t let Josh play high school football, which would’ve put his baseball career at risk.

    Seeing how Josh Bell is making $6,350,000 this season, his dad was smart.
